Claims
- 1. A fuel composition comprising a hydrocarbon boiling in the gasoline or diesel range and from about 10 to about 10,000 parts per million of a polyamino alkenyl or alkyl succinimide wherein one or more of the nitrogens of the polyamino moiety is substituted with: ##STR37## wherein R.sub.4 is alkylene of from 1 to 6 carbon atoms excluding R.sub.4 groups wherein ##STR38## wherein R.sub.11 is the remainder of the R.sub.4 group; m is an integer of from 0 to 2; R.sub.5 is alkylene of from 2 to 5 carbon atoms; p is an integer of from 1 to 100; R.sub.6 is selected from the group consisting of hydrogen and hydrocarbyl of from 1 to 30 carbon atoms; and with the proviso that if m is one or two, then R.sub.6 is hydrogen.
- 2. The fuel composition defined in claim 1 wherein the alkenyl or alkyl group is from about 20 to 300 carbon atoms.
- 3. The fuel composition defined in claim 2 wherein m is zero and R.sub.6 is hydrogen.
- 4. The fuel composition defined in claim 3 wherein p is an integer of from 1 to 30.
- 5. The fuel composition defined in claim 4 wherein R.sub.4 is alkylene of from 1 to 4 carbon atoms.
- 6. The fuel composition defined in claim 5 wherein R.sub.5 is alkylene of from 2 to 4 carbon atoms.
